Transaction cd59ea504d33de34f5ae1f394ebc62b696c1bf7baef7a87d6b7a9711e48a5aa4
1 Input
2 Outputs
- cd59ea504d33de34f5ae1f394ebc62b696c1bf7baef7a87d6b7a9711e48a5aa4:0
- cd59ea504d33de34f5ae1f394ebc62b696c1bf7baef7a87d6b7a9711e48a5aa4:1
value 72710
address 3CanFYLh8L7hD8QnRAp7YPPuGFMrDwjThy
value 1493575
address 1PGSWXqVWmDiZBmCNFJxCKBFaqv2RykrCw